  • Abstract
    The basic knowledge of virtual reality and virtual instrument technique were introduced. According to the present safety conditions of foundation excavation, the support monitoring system of foundation excavation is put forward. With Windows and Lab VIEW technologies, the support monitoring system of foundation excavation is developed, which is integrated with data automatically collecting, information treatment, analytical evaluation, and automatically displaying the state of excavation by 3D visualization technology. Furthermore, it takes important meaning to restrict the strain, ensure the safety of the excavation and protect the surrounding environment.
